- Abstract : A nanosecond pulse erbium‐doped fibre laser (EDFL) is demonstrated based on nonlinear polarisation rotation effect using a highly concentrated EDF in a ring cavity. The EDFL generates a stable multi‐wavelength comb with a constant spacing of 0.22 nm in the 1533.6 nm wavelength region at a pump power of 87.6 mW. A stable mode‐locked operation also commences with a constant repetition rate of 77 MHz with pulse width that varies from 5.3 to 6.8 ns as the pump power is increased from 87.6 to 168.9 mW. With careful adjustment of the polarisation controller, a stable square pulse is obtainable at a pump power of 128.3 mW with a pulse width of 6.5 ns and an average output power of 5.0 mW, which translates to the pulse energy of 35 pJ. The square pulse is generated based on the nonlinear polarisation switching effect inside the laser cavity.
